Meddling and Harshness
Al-Adab Al-Mufrad 1316
Abu Mas'ud said, "The Prophet, may Allah bless him and grant him
peace, said, "Part of what people know of the words of first prophethood
is that if someone does not possess shyness, then he will do as he pleases."
حَدَّثَنَا آدَمُ، قَالَ: حَدَّثَنَا شُعْبَةُ، عَنْ مَنْصُورٍ قَالَ: سَمِعْتُ رِبْعِيَّ بْنَ حِرَاشٍ يُحَدِّثُ، عَنْ أَبِي مَسْعُودٍ قَالَ: قَالَ النَّبِيُّ صلى الله عليه وسلم: إِنَّ مِمَّا أَدْرَكَ النَّاسَ مِنْ كَلاَمِ النُّبُوَّةِ الأُولَى: إِذَا لَمْ تَسْتَحْيِ فَاصْنَعْ مَا شِئْتَ.
